Photo Of The Day By Stacy Howell
Photo By Stacy Howell
Today’s Photo Of The Day is “Ice Fishing” by Stacy Howell. Location: Farmington Bay Wildlife Management Area, Utah.
“Blue Herons fishing along the sliver of open water in the ice,” describes Howell.
